How many cameras do you need for a short film?
One camera is enough. May be if you have budget you can go for 2nd camera. For talkie 1 cam is enough but for fights you need 2 or sometimes 3 cameras say while picturizing a blast. It is a lot easier to edit multiple camera angles than shoot with one and think you have it all.

Can you make a short film with one camera?
Using one camera when shooting a scene allows the crew to be more focused. It also allows for specific lighting setups to be created that simply could not be used with multiple cameras. Filmmakers can save a lot of money using a single camera for the duration of shooting the film.

Can a short film make money?
In short: They don’t. On very rare occasions some festivals might offer a cash award, so that is a way they could make some money back. There is also the even more remote chance of some sort of distribution, but even if, it will likely make little to no money. Basically, short films don’t make money.

How much does a short film cost?
According to Newbie Film School, the average short film costs between $700 and $1,500 per minute, with the possibility of shooting up higher. Regardless of the length of a film, though, the reality is that filmmaking is an expensive business all around.
What does B roll mean in film?
In video production, B-roll footage is the secondary video footage shot outside of the primary (or A-roll) footage. It is often spliced together with the main footage to bolster the story, create dramatic tension, or further illustrate a point.

Can you shoot a short film with an Iphone?
You can shoot pretty much any kind of film with an iOS device. But if you’re planning to shoot and edit on your phone, it’s best to keep the movie short and simple. It’s tricky to manage a long, complex movie on a phone or tablet.

How do I submit a short film to Netflix?
Pitching an idea to Netflix
If you have an idea, game, script, screenplay, or production already in development that you’d like to pitch to Netflix, you must work through a licensed agent, producer, attorney, manager, or industry executive, as appropriate, who already has a relationship with Netflix.

How much do actors get paid for short films?
Union Actor Pay
ABS Payroll lists the 2020 SAG minimums as follows: Basic Theatrical Scale (Film): $1,030 per day or $3,575 per week. Motion Picture Association (MPA) Scale: $360 per day or $1,251 per week. Short Film Scale: $206 per day.
How long are short films?
A. A short film is defined as an original motion picture that has a running time of 40 minutes or less, including all credits.
How much does it cost to make a movie on Netflix?
Netflix doesn’t publicly disclose its deals, but from what we managed to gather around the Internet, Netflix is currently paying between $100 and $250 million for blockbuster movies, while popular TV shows with multiple seasons have budgets that range from $300 to $500 million.
